Score Breakdown

DimensionClaudeMeta AI / Llama
Data Residency
Where is your data stored and processed?
Claude: Regional processing available via AWS Bedrock, GCP Vertex AI, and Azure in EU, UK, US, and more
Meta AI / Llama: Hosted Meta AI processes data in US data centres with no EU residency option. Self-hosted Llama deployments can achieve a score of 5 with EU-region infrastructure. Scores here reflect the hosted product.
4/5
1/5
Legal Jurisdiction
Which laws govern the company and your data?
Claude: US Delaware PBC subject to CLOUD Act; SCCs and DPAs available for EU transfers
Meta AI / Llama: Meta Platforms Inc. is a US company subject to the CLOUD Act and has been repeatedly fined by EU DPAs for GDPR violations. Multiple rulings against Meta's data transfer mechanisms make the hosted product high-risk for EU businesses.
3/5
1/5
Data Retention & Training
Is your data used for model training?
Claude: Commercial customer data never used for model training by default
Meta AI / Llama: Hosted Meta AI interactions may be used to improve Meta's models under default settings. Self-hosted Llama: no data retention or training by the model provider. Scores reflect the hosted product with limited user controls.
5/5
2/5
Certifications
ISO 27001, SOC 2, Cyber Essentials, etc.
Claude: SOC 2 Type II, ISO 27001, ISO 42001, and HIPAA certified
Meta AI / Llama: Meta's core infrastructure holds SOC 2 Type II and ISO 27001 certifications for its platform services. However, these certifications cover Meta's broader infrastructure and are not specific to the AI assistant product.
4/5
3/5
Regulatory Fit
Suitability for regulated industries and professional services
Claude: Suitable for regulated industries including healthcare (HIPAA BAA) and financial services
Meta AI / Llama: Hosted Meta AI is not suitable for regulated EU industries. Meta's track record with European regulators is one of the weakest among major technology companies. Self-hosted Llama is an excellent option for EU sovereignty when deployed responsibly.
4/5
1/5
